- [ ] Step 7: Archive cold storage buckets (Glacierline tier). Confirm both ceremony witnesses are present, verify bucket manifests match the Oxbow ledger, then seal the archive key shares. Plugin authors may observe but not handle shares. Once sealed, the archive index itself is encrypted and can only be reopened with the passphrase below.

vault phrase of badup-hahig = tamael-aldael-kelmir-istael-fenok-istwyn-tamius-jorath-oliion

## Releases

Hey support folks — quick notes on ProfileMesh shard releases. Each release re-balances user-profile shards gradually, so don't panic if a lookup lands on a stale shard for a few minutes post-deploy; it self-heals. Release bundles are published twice a month and are always signed. If a customer asks you to verify a bundle they downloaded, walk them through the checksum step using the public signing key below.

deploy key for kawif-bageg: bky19_YQNdHDgpaLxUNwPoHm9

Ticket #~ Maprelle tile cache vault locked

Hey plugin folks — after yesterday's deploy, the tile-rendering cache layer sealed its credentials vault mid-rotation, so any plugin calling the warm-cache endpoint is getting 403s. Not your fault, nothing to patch on your side. We're unsealing it now and renderer throughput should recover within the hour. If you maintain a self-hosted Maprelle node and hit the same lockout, you can unseal locally with the standard tool; it will ask for the passphrase below.

recovery phrase for bawef-kagug: casix-tamvan-lamath-holeth-gilmir-drudor-julax-wenok-wenael-rusvan-holax-goriel-frawyn